What is a WARN notice?
A WARN (Worker Adjustment and Retraining Notification) notice is a US federal law that requires employers to provide workers with at least 60 days' advance notice of plant closings or mass layoffs, explains the U.S. Department of Labor.
The notice provides employees with time to prepare for job loss and seek alternative employment, says Cincinnati Enquirer.
State-level WARN acts
Ohio: On September 29, 2025, Ohio joined 13 other states by enacting a "mini-WARN" Act, which supplements federal WARN notice requirements for employers in the state, notes Workforce Bulletin.
California: In October 2025, California expanded its Cal-WARN Act with the signing of Senate Bill 617, expanding the state's requirements starting in January 2026, reports California Employment Law Report.
